gpt4 book ai didi

php - 通过 URL 传递密码的安全方法?

转载 作者:行者123 更新时间:2023-12-02 07:13:33 26 4
gpt4 key购买 nike

我想知道是否有一种安全的方法可以通过 URL 传递密码(比如 ?p=mypassword)我怎样才能加密和解密这样的密码以使其安全。

我猜 md5 在我的情况下不起作用,因为密码必须仍然可读。它是一个 FTP 密码,可以传递给 ftp_connect。我认为 md5 在这种情况下不起作用,因为我必须查询字符串是否与 md5 哈希匹配。但是我不能这样做。

有什么想法吗?

最佳答案

呃:通过 POST + SSL 发送

SSL 确保密码在传输过程中不会被第三方轻易读取。通过 POST 发送它只是将变量发送到 URL 之外的服务器,并将其保留在服务器日志之外(希望如此)。这可以很好地将它从浏览器历史记录或嗅探 HTTP 的人中隐藏起来。

但是,ftp_login() 不是在使用 ftp_connect() 来 mock HTTP 中的 SSL 时发送这个明文吗?确保之后使用 ftp_ssl_connect() 连接到您的服务器。查看ftp_ssl_connect() PHP手动录入

关于php - 通过 URL 传递密码的安全方法?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/3294862/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com